Description

This form is a Bill of Sale. The sellers relinquish to the buyer furniture, equipment, inventory, and supplies. The sellers guarantee that the items sold are solely owned by them and the property is free from any and all claims.

The Utah Sale of Business — Bill of Sale for Personal Asset— - Asset Purchase Transaction is a legal document that outlines the terms and conditions of the sale of a business's personal assets in the state of Utah. This transaction involves the transfer of ownership of various assets from the seller to the buyer, and it serves as a binding agreement between both parties. Keywords: Utah, Sale of Business, Bill of Sale, Personal Assets, Asset Purchase Transaction There are different types of Utah Sale of Business — Bill of Sale for Personal Asset— - Asset Purchase Transactions. Some common types include: 1. Equipment Purchase Transaction: This type of transaction specifically focuses on the sale of equipment used by the business, such as machinery, vehicles, computers, or tools. 2. Inventory Purchase Transaction: This type of transaction involves the sale of inventory held by the business, including goods, raw materials, finished products, or supplies. 3. Intellectual Property Purchase Transaction: In this type of transaction, the sale of intellectual property assets, such as patents, copyrights, trademarks, or trade secrets, takes place. 4. Real Estate Purchase Transaction: This type of transaction deals with the sale of real estate assets owned by the business, such as land, buildings, offices, or warehouses. Regardless of the specific type, a Utah Sale of Business — Bill of Sale for Personal Asset— - Asset Purchase Transaction typically includes the following key elements: — Identification of the buyer and seller: The document should clearly outline the legal names and contact information of both the buyer and seller involved in the transaction. — Asset description: A detailed description of the assets being sold should be included. This may include serial numbers, model numbers, specifications, or any other relevant information necessary for accurate asset identification. — Purchase price: The agreed-upon purchase price for the assets must be clearly stated in the document. This should include any applicable taxes, fees, or other financial terms. — Terms and conditions: The bill of sale should outline the terms and conditions of the sale, including any warranties, non-compete agreements, or dispute resolution procedures. — Transfer of ownership: The document should specify how and when the transfer of ownership will occur. This may include the date of transfer, the mode of transfer, and any necessary documentation or approvals. — Signatures and notarization: Both parties involved in the transaction must sign the bill of sale to indicate their acceptance and agreement to its terms. Depending on the nature of the transaction, notarization may also be required for legal validity. In conclusion, the Utah Sale of Business — Bill of Sale for Personal Asset— - Asset Purchase Transaction is a crucial legal document that ensures a smooth and lawful transfer of personal assets between a buyer and a seller in the state of Utah. With various types of transactions available, it's important to clearly specify the type of assets being sold and include all necessary details and terms within the document.

A business asset purchase agreement (APA) is a standard merger & acquisition contract that contains the terms for transferring an asset between parties. The terms in an APA provide key logistics about the deal (e.g., purchase price, closing date, payment, etc.) along with the rights and obligations of the parties.

In an asset purchase, the buyer will only buy certain assets of the seller's company. The seller will continue to own the assets that were not included in the purchase agreement with the buyer. The transfer of ownership of certain assets may need to be confirmed with filings, such as titles to transfer real estate.

Provisions of an APA may include payment of purchase price, monthly installments, liens and encumbrances on the assets, condition precedent for the closing, etc. An APA differs from a stock purchase agreement (SPA) under which company shares, title to assets, and title to liabilities are also sold.

An asset sale involves the purchase of some or all of the assets owned by a company. Examples of common assets which are sold include; plant and equipment, land, buildings, machinery, stock, goodwill, contracts, records and intellectual property (including domain names and trademarks).

A business usually has many assets. When sold, these assets must be classified as capital assets, depreciable property used in the business, real property used in the business, or property held for sale to customers, such as inventory or stock in trade. The gain or loss on each asset is figured separately.

The bill of sale is typically delivered as an ancillary document in an asset purchase to transfer title to tangible personal property. It does not cover intangible property (such as intellectual property rights or contract rights) or real property.
